Tropical Cancun beach retreat near the convention center and nightlife
The tranquil, upscale InterContinental Presidente Cancun Resort is steps from the sparkling Caribbean Sea. The resort is convenient for both leisure and business travelers with an address near the convention center and nightlife. Two outdoor pools, a whirlpool, massage services and a 24-hour fitness center are met by offerings such as water sports, two restaurants, two bars and a casual cafe. Contemporary guest rooms feature ocean, garden or lagoon views and are swathed in marble with Herman Miller chairs, rain showers and ambient lighting.

Rooms
Each of the 289 guest rooms at the InterContinental Presidente Cancun Resort have one king or two double beds and are adorned in marble and tile with expansive windows or balconies facing the ocean, lagoon or verdant grounds. Additional amenities include direct-dial telephones, air-conditioning, mini bars and bathrooms with shower-bathtubs and vanity mirrors. Renovated rooms also feature iHome radios, Melitta coffee machines, LCD TVs, rain showers and Herman Miller chairs as well as ambient LED lighting. Club-level rooms on a private floor feature continental breakfast.
Features
The beachfront InterContinental Presidente Cancun Resort has two outdoor pools, five whirlpools and a 24-hour fitness center. The resort is near the convention center and the entertainment district in downtown Cancun. Offerings include water sports, wireless Internet service and massage services. Two restaurants, one specializing in Caribbean seafood, and a tequila bar pouring more than 600 labels completes the experience.

Good Experience
I had a nice time in this hotel. I recommend mostly for family or low key people who dont want to be in the middle of stuff or for those looking for a good value. The exterior is not quite as nice as many of the other hotels, but inside and the pool/beach area were very nice and well maintained. We had a nice 1st floor room with a patio and hammock. The bed was a little hard for my friends taste, but I thought it was ok. Furniture was standard hotel fare and the bathroom was quite nice stone accents and the like. The food was pretty good at the restaurants here. The breakfast buffet was excellent and its worth getting on orbits ($7 or whatever it is per day) because price there is much higher (about 3 times). The orbizs rep there had packages for tours, and the prices were very negotiable so may want to wait to book these things in person. Maids were good and leaving 20 pesos they even folded cloths and arranged things for you. Roomservice was was ok. The service was slow and the food was pretty good (better than most room service but still not that good). The front desk was very attentive, but a little stingy on what bills they would exchange (I broght money direct from the bank in the states and they would not accept some for minor tares and such). The pools and beach were excellent as were the grounds. Pool/beach side service was not great, but ordering yourself from the bar was not too inconvenient. The bus was right outside and frequent. Avoid taxis if possible because they overcharge (and hail from street not from hotel for cheaper negotiable rates). Location is pretty good. Not too far from Hotel zone stuff or town, but not in the middle of things either.
